Huntersville Senior Club Turns 50

NORFOLK
The Huntersville Senior Club spent the month of October celebrating 50 Years of service to the community. On Tuesday, October 30, the group held its Memorial Service to remember club members who had passed on by lighting candle in their memory. Also, certificates of appreciation were given to current members.
Persons participating on the program were Sis. Jocelyn Amstead, Bro, Steven Garner, Bro Van Armstead, Sis. Barbara Black, Bro. Jamel Walker, Sis. Pearl Johnson, Sis. Mariel Perry, Sis. Evelyn Haskins. President Dolores Studivant gave closing remarks after lunch was served.
